The 50-day or 25-weekend, 2-semester dissertation schedule
Estimate that your dissertation will be 100 pages long. Writing at a rate of only one double-spaced page an hour, you will take 14.29 seven-hour days, 3 workweeks or 7 weekends. Figure revisions on one page in four, so add four more days. List dissertation writing as 20 days.
In addition,
conducting, collecting, and analyzing the data, + 10 workdays;
literature search and organization, + 8 workdays;
writing proposal Plan 4 workdays;
researching your committee +2 workdays;
selecting a topic +4 workdays;
researching dissertation formats +2 workdays.
(7 hour a day working)
Sample Dissertation Timeline
Sept.7 Complete researching completed dissertations.
Sept.15 Complete researching committee.
Sept.25 Complete preliminary literature and topic search.
Sept.30 Finalize advisor/committee.
Oct.10 Finalize topic.
Oct.25 Complete dissertation prospectus.
Nov.7 Proposal accepted.
Nov.8 Develop detailed work plan.
Nov.9
to Implement plan and write dissertation
Apr. 15
Feb.20 Apply for diploma dated June.
Apr.15 Deliver final dissertation to committee.
May.1 Succcessfully complete the oral defense.
May.5 Celebrate Dr.___with a party.
May.15 Deliver revised final dissertation and abstracts to the dissertation office.
June.1 Graduate.
June.1 Enjoy graduation party
